
For Robert Taylor and Caroline Read of Above + Below London, the seats on London’s Tube trains and buses offer more than a means of conveyance. They’re also an incredible source of vintage textiles, which the a U.K.-based design company salvages for its eco-friendly shoe range. The resulting collection of striking high-tops is reminiscent of the legendary classic Chuck Taylors, but with a clever retro-modern twist that the foggy town can call its own.

Made using reclaimed upholstery uppers, recycled leather trim, and recycled tire soles, the limited-edition kicks showcase distinct patterns from London subway and bus lines, from Piccadilly to Victoria. Not only are the shoes a step in the right direction toward a greener planet, but they’re also a slice of London history, making them just the ticket for traversing above, below, or anywhere in between.
